As many of you know, Melissa was diagnosed with melanoma five years ago.  At that time, the cancer was isolated to lymph nodes under her arm which were successfully removed through surgery.  Since then she has continued regular check-ups at the Mayo Clinic.  On August 15, Melissa was back in Rochester for her latest check-up; however, this check-up would not turn out to be a regular one by far.  Her PET scan showed the cancer has returned and was found on her liver and spleen. A biopsy was done on her liver in order to do BRAF testing which indicates whether the cancer cells are a mutated or wild style type.  The type then determines the treatment course. Unfortunately, the BRAF testing has failed multiple times so her physicians have chosen to move ahead and treat her like it is the more aggressive wild style form.  She will start IPI/NIVO treatments tomorrow.  

Melissa is at Mayo where she has a great team of physicians and through her work at 3M she has also had the fortune to be connected with a leading melanoma expert, Dr. Patrick Hwu, from MD Anderson in Texas.
